The Materials Specialist is responsible for sustaining and overseeing medical and/or surgical supplies, and providing service and support to clinicians, physicians, and City of Hope departments to care for the patients we serve.
As a successful candidate, you will:
- Analyze item usage and cost to determine and adjust stock levels, reduce inventory cost, execute action on material phase-in and phase-out
- Work with Purchasing to obtain technical information, specifications, recommended vendors, understand backorder risks, determine substitute material availability, communicate risks or concerns to supply, manage open orders and RTV requests
- Review transactions daily to ensure supply issuances, receiving, inventory adjustments, and any other transactions are performed accurately
- Complete requisitions for supplies that are needed, and submit to Purchasing prior to cut-off time
- Execute daily inventory transactions (e.g. Receipts, transfers, fulfillments, adjustments, express issues, etc.) accurately and same-day
- Coordinate with purchasing, supply chain, receiving personnel, vendors and accounts payable personnel to resolve problems encountered with purchase orders.
- Execute cycle counts daily, expiration date management, cleaning and maintenance of inventory and bins, correct labeling and barcoding of inventory and inventory storage locations, and other actions maintenance on a regular cadence to ensure inventory accuracy and quality.
